草庐IT

php - 无法连接到 PHP 中的 SSRS

我正在使用SSRSSDKforPHPPHP版本5.4网络服务器:Centos6.4MSSQL服务器2008R2define("UID","*****\*****");define("PASWD","*****");define("SERVICE_URL","http://192.168.0.1/ReportServerURL/");try{$ssrs_report=newSSRSReport(newCredentials(UID,PASWD),SERVICE_URL);}catch(SSRSReportException$serviceException){echo$serviceEx

SSRS报告构建器差异%

我正在尝试计算一个差异百分比,并避免除以0错误下面的该代码适用于总体差异百分比=IIf(Sum(Fields!Baseline.Value)=0,0,Sum(Fields!test.Value))/IIf(Sum(Fields!Baseline.Value)=0,1,Sum(Fields!Baseline.Value))我现在正在尝试将其限制为某个类别,并尝试使用以下表达式=IIF(Fields!Category.Value="ResourcesCapital",IIf(Sum(Fields!Baseline.Value)=0,0,Sum(Fields!test.Value))/IIf(Sum

获取NAN错误SSRS

遇到NAN错误。我的原始陈述是:=SUM(Fields!Outstanding_Commitments.Value/Fields!Conversion.Value,"Cost")遇到NAN错误后,我将代码更改为以下内容:=IIF(Double.IsNAN(SUM(Fields!Outstanding_Commitments.Value/Fields!Conversion.Value,"Cost")),0,SUM(Fields!Outstanding_Commitments.Value/Fields!Conversion.Value,"Cost"))使用第二部分根本没有为我提供任何值。有些不对劲

访问另一个数据集(SSRS)中的一个数据集

两个不同的服务器上有2个表,我的DataSet1指向Server1。同样,我将DataSet2指向Server2。现在,我想在DataSet2中使用DataSet1中的一些值。数据集1:-Select*fromTable1这有名字,莱特(Lessthan)DataSet2:-Select*fromTableXXinnerjoinDataset1onDataset1.name=TableX.nameWhereX.Time>Dataset1.LessthanandX.Time>Dataset1.GreaterThan已经尝试执行与上面相同的尝试,但是我们无法访问dataset2中的数据集1的内容它

饼图中的过滤器不起作用SSRS

由于某种原因,我无法使过滤器功能正常工作。我有4个标记为a,b,c,D的选项。然后,我有图表中表示的值是点。我转到图表属性,然后转到“数据”选项卡。我转到类别,然后选择编辑,然后选择过滤器。在这里,我将表达式选择为=fields!options.valueoperatoras=valueasa我想对整个选项a做一个派图。当我使用上面的设置时,该图甚至没有显示。如果我取出过滤器,则图表显示了所有4个选项Itriedvalue=A"A"="A"Butnothingworks.有人可以帮我吗?看答案解决此问题的工作将是将您的选项放入参数,然后将图表的过滤器设置为等同于所选参数。

android - SSRS 网页的 Monodroid WebView 身份验证

我已经尝试过两次尝试通过身份验证访问网站,但我不确定我的尝试有什么问题。我会列出每一个。有没有人试过这个并让它工作?这对于JavaAndroid程序员来说应该不难理解,我使用的是monodroidEDIT也不重要(这很重要,因为我下面有一个Java实现可以正常工作)结束编辑。我正在尝试通过WebView访问SSRSRDL,我需要插入一些通用凭据。Activity:publicstaticstringusername="...";publicstaticstringpassword="...";publicstaticstringwebsite="http://10.0.0.5/Repo

SSRS独立公式

我已经做了几天了,尚未解决。如果您知道自己在做什么,可能很简单。我只是试图制作一个不在Tablix或其他任何内容中的独立公式,而只是在文本框中。这是我的数据集的示例,称为dataset1:当类别是DataSet1的劳动力时,我要获得的是实际成本的总和。我目前的表达是:=Sum(iif(Fields!Category.Value="Labor",Fields!ActualCost.Value,0),"Dataset1")我将DataSet1称为我的范围,因为否则,我会出现关于使用无范围的聚合表达式的错误。该报告运行,但在文本框中显示#Error,其中包含我的表达方式。当我用1替换fields!a

mysql - 如何通过 openquery 和链接服务器在 VS 中使用 MySQL 数据为 SSRS 2008 报告创建数据集

我已经成功地在SQLServer2005中创建了一个到MySQL数据库的链接服务器。我需要从VS调用/执行MySQL存储过程(以刷新MySQL中的表数据),然后使用此数据创建数据集以用于SSRS2008中的报告。我可以毫无问题地从SSMS查询窗口运行以下命令:select*fromopenquery(myLinkedSrvrname,'callmyMySQLprocname')但是我无法从VS中的查询设计器窗口运行此语句来创建数据集。它会产生语法错误。谁能建议修复上述openquery语句或知道如何从ReportingServices执行MySQL存储过程来创建数据集?错误代码Aner

查找是否存在6个月前SSRS

在SSRS报告构建器中,我试图在我的数据集中编写一个计算字段的表达式,以查看此数据是否存在,现在存在6个月前,并且存在于一年前。(因此3个不同的计算字段)。我不想使用不同的数据集,因为所有信息都需要进入具有百分比更改列的表。我有数据的日期,并且一直在尝试按照=IIF(Fields!From.Value-6months,true,false)我显然缺少表达的东西,但是我的知识是有限的。关于如何使它做我想做的事情的任何想法?我的数据基本上是这个(但是从数据库中的各个表中提取)人ID-条件1-从日期到日期人ID-条件2-从日期到日期人ID-条件1-从日期到日期人ID-条件3-从日期到日期等等我被要求

合并在SSRS报告的列标题中

我在创建我的时偶然发现了一个问题SSR报告。我希望能够如下图所示显示我的桌子标题:我似乎无法正确处理,我尝试使用一个组并在该组中添加行作为工作,但没有找到解决问题的可靠解决方案。我不是专家SSR但已经研究了一些报告。任何专家建议都将不胜感激。看答案您可以像下面的图像一样将桌子嵌套在另一个嵌套中。嵌套表(灰色表)可以具有静态甚至动态数据